Honours

The Human Geography honours program provides advanced training in geographical research and methodology to outstanding, highly motivated students.

Curriculum

The Honours program differs from the major in two respects: degree of specialization and standing, which must be at least 74% average of all courses taken for entry and graduation.

Students will be expected to complete 48 credits of upper-level geography courses.

For the degree of specialization, they must complete 18 credits, with six credits from each of the following themes:

  • Cultures and Places
  • Cities and Globalization
  • Nature and Society

One of these courses must have substantial focus beyond North America.

To complete the program, students will need to complete 12 additional credits on top of the above curriculum.

*Please note that students in the Human Geography Honours program may not complete a minor in Human Geography or Environment and Sustainability.

Admissions

Students who are interested in the Honours program should consult with the Geography Undergraduate Advisor before the end of their second year or at the beginning of their third year. There are a limited number of seats available and students applying must hold a minimum average of 74% for all geography courses.
